What are the qualifications for a scientific explanation to be testable?

Scientific explanations are testable if confidence in the explanation could be undermined by a failure to observe the predicted outcome. One should be able to imagine outcomes that would disprove the explanation.


What does Explanation mean in science mean in science?

Explanations must be Consistent. The explanation for one set of phenomena cannot contradict the explanation for other sets of phenomena. If explanations are inconsistent, they must be rectified or abandoned. Explanations must be Testable. Explanations must be examined in laboratories, in nature, in the field or through the study of past events and must be capable of shown to be incorrect. If they are incorrect they must be changed or abandoned. Preferred Explanations should be Elegant (Simple). Explanations that require the invention of the fewest "missing pieces" have the greatest reliability. Explanations cannot include pieces that are either inconsistent with what is already known or that are untestable.


Why is science is limited?

Science is limited by its reliance on direct observation and testable hypotheses. Due to this fact, science cannot make judgments about values, ethics, or morality. "Science can reveal how the world is, but not how it should be." (Castro & Huber, 2010)

Is a theory a hypothesis that hasn't been proven true?

The question is stated incorrectly. It should ask: "Is theory a hypothesis that HAS been proven true?" (my emphasis) 1) A hypothesis in science is merely a conjecture put forth to provide a basis for further debate and to conceive research and experiments. It is a working guess, not an untested theory. 2) A theory is a comprehensive set of explanations for known phenomena. It must make testable predictions that can be confirmed or reputed. 3) When you make explanations without testable predictions, it is called philosophy. To sneer "That is just a theory" is to misunderstand just how much effort goes into producing a testable theory. ## So the answer is No.

What are attributes of a good hypothesis?

A good hypothesis is specific, testable, and falsifiable, meaning it can be proven true or false through observation or experimentation. It should also be based on existing knowledge or evidence, and provide a clear direction for further investigation. Additionally, a good hypothesis should be logical and relevant to the research question being addressed.
